Transaction 591c7df2500564e71e80c6d93432f25534c4c8b61ad64ad6e3024e14c09eb074

2 Input
2 Outputs
  • 591c7df2500564e71e80c6d93432f25534c4c8b61ad64ad6e3024e14c09eb074:0
  • value  5000000
    address  1G1FFgNHYPfVRC1jDvTfUDTAuzEuf2xMbF
  • 591c7df2500564e71e80c6d93432f25534c4c8b61ad64ad6e3024e14c09eb074:1
  • value  1426979
    address  185NRDUpCAZQ3kjo6niBfmiTAwGr26VtuG